Filter and sort

Filter and sort

138 products

Availability

138 products

138 products

Availability
$36.00 CAD
 per 
Sold out
$187.00 CAD
 per 
$187.00 CAD
 per 
$51.00 CAD
 per 
$51.00 CAD
 per